Rumah > pembangunan bahagian belakang > Tutorial Python > Mengapa Saya Tidak Boleh Mengimport Modul Python Saya yang Dipasang?

Mengapa Saya Tidak Boleh Mengimport Modul Python Saya yang Dipasang?

Linda Hamilton
Lepaskan: 2024-12-15 21:19:09
asal
205 orang telah melayarinya

Why Can't I Import My Installed Python Module?

Tidak Dapat Mengimport Modul yang Dipasang: Teka-teki Kebenaran

Pengenalan: Ramai pembangun telah menghadapi ralat yang mengecewakan tidak dapat mengimport modul walaupun pemasangannya berjaya. Isu ini boleh muncul dalam pelbagai senario dan selalunya disebabkan oleh pelbagai faktor. Salah satu faktor sedemikian, sering diabaikan, ialah kebenaran fail modul.

Masalahnya: Walaupun memasang modul mekanis melalui pengurus pakej yang bereputasi atau repositori rasmi, Python terus membuang ImportError apabila mencuba untuk mengimport modul.

Analisis: Isu dalam kes ini dikesan kembali ke kebenaran fail. Modul mekanisasi telah dipasang dengan kebenaran baca dan tulis peringkat akar, dengan berkesan menghalang akses kepada pengguna lain.

Penyelesaian: Untuk menyelesaikan isu ini, pastikan modul yang dipasang mempunyai kebenaran yang sesuai. Biasanya, adalah disyorkan untuk memberikan kebenaran baca-tulis kepada pengguna atau kumpulan pengguna semasa.

Pelaksanaan: Untuk melaraskan kebenaran fail, buka terminal dan navigasi ke direktori yang mengandungi modul. Jalankan arahan berikut untuk memberikan kebenaran baca-tulis kepada pengguna semasa:

sudo chmod u+rw module_name
Salin selepas log masuk

Keputusan: Selepas mengubah suai kebenaran fail, cubaan semula untuk mengimport modul akan menghasilkan import yang berjaya .

Kesimpulan: Walaupun isu ini mungkin timbul dalam konteks yang berbeza dan dengan pelbagai modul, memahami punca yang berpotensi, seperti kebenaran fail, boleh membantu dalam menyelesaikan masalah dan mencari penyelesaian yang sesuai.

Atas ialah kandungan terperinci Mengapa Saya Tidak Boleh Mengimport Modul Python Saya yang Dipasang?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el terbaru oleh pengarang
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an